The recipe for the Jam Tea Cookies is posted on the blog Chew Out Loud, run by mother of three Amy Dong.

This recipe is a version of a recipe from a book published in 1992.

Recipe for cookies, ingredients:

  • 1 cup of softened margarine
  • ½ cup powdered sugar, plus ¼ for dusting
  • 2 teaspoons of vanilla extract
  • ¼ pinch of salt
  • 2 cups flour
  • ½ cup fruit jam

Recipe for cookies, preparation:

  • Heat the oven to 160 degrees. Put baking paper in the tray.
  • Mix margarine and sugar in a bowl. Add vanilla and salt and mix everything, then slowly add flour until everything is combined, but do not beat too much.
  • Roll the dough into a roller and then cut it into equal balls, up to 3 centimeters wide.
  • Then make a hole in the middle of each one, in which you will put the jam.
  • Bake for 12-15 minutes until they become golden-brown (depending on the oven), but it is important that they are not overcooked.

It is necessary to cool them for a few minutes and then sprinkle them with powdered sugar.
